Enable Dual Volume Sliders on Sprint TP2?

I found this thread for Verizon, but thought I'd ask before making reg edits.

http://forum.ppcgeeks.com/showthread.php?t=92207

I only have a single volume slider, and there's no "Sounds" app under settings > system.

Am I missing something?

They don't have a "sounds" setting in the settings tab in manila/touchflo3d?
On the Sprint version if you go there, there is an option to toggle between single volume and both

Re: Enable Dual Volume Sliders on Sprint TP2?

After turning the single volume setting to off, hit you volume rocker and you should see at the top "System" and "Ring". Just tap either one to set it.
